Climate_CRICES Partner meeting hosted in Turin: Driving sustainable climate action across regions

Date: 07.09.2026
 

Hosted by project partner CSI Piemonte, the collaborative event brought together regional project partners both in person and online.

Key Highlights & Focus Areas

Throughout the two-day session, participants engaged in:

  • Pilot Action progress: Partners reviewed key outcomes from localized pilot initiatives across partner regions, exploring real-world impacts and lessons learned from initial testing phases.
  • Long-term sustainability: Special attention was given to ensuring that solutions developed within the project are resilient, scalable, and capable of delivering lasting benefits beyond the project’s lifespan.
  • Data-driven Dashboard: The team reviewed the ongoing development and release of the Climate_CRICES digital dashboard – an innovative tool designed to help regional authorities monitor environmental factors and make data-backed climate decisions.
